    Hi

    I have bought a 3 ZTE MF10 wireless router off e bay. I am wondering if it is faulty, the seller insists it is not.

    I have a 3 Huawei E353 Hi Link dongle, I have checked various sites and found that it is compatible. When the dongle is in my lap top I receive a very strong and fast signal (I am in Wallingford, Oxfordshire). However when I put the dongle in the hub, the lap top connects to the hub , the network centre says hub connected but no internet signal. I gather from this that for some reason the hub is not getting the signal from the dongle even though it is inserted. I have tried resetting the hub back to factory settings by keeping the power button pressed. Also tried moving it around to different positions, but I would not have thought that mattered as I gather the dongle is the signal receiver.

    A further problem I am having is that when I retry the dongle directly into my lap top it does not work, the blue light on the dongle is solid but lap top has no internet. However I have found if I turn the lap top of and on again the dongle then works in the lap top.

    I have tried it on another lap top, same result

    Can anyone please give me some idea if I am right in thinking the hub is faulty in which case I will return to seller for a refund, but would like to try and be sure first.
